Enhancing Hygiene and Reducing Bacterial Growth
Maintaining hygiene is one of the paramount reasons to use a helmet cleaner machine. Helmets inevitably accumulate sweat, oils, dead skin cells, and other contaminants that create a breeding ground for bacteria and fungi. Without regular and proper cleaning, these microorganisms can flourish, giving rise to unpleasant odors, skin irritations, or even infections.
Helmet cleaner machines are designed with advanced sanitizing technologies, often equipped with ultraviolet (UV) light, steam, or ozone cleaning mechanisms, which effectively kill bacteria and germs that hand or standard cleaning methods might miss. The UV light component, in particular, provides sterilization by penetrating microbial cells and disrupting their DNA, making it impossible for them to reproduce. This means that every time you clean your helmet using such a machine, you are not only removing visible dirt but also ensuring microscopic pathogens are eliminated.
Additionally, these machines typically avoid harsh chemicals that could damage the helmet’s materials or leave behind residue. They rely on non-invasive, eco-friendly methods that protect the helmet’s integrity while optimizing hygiene. Regular use of a helmet cleaner machine reduces the need for frequent deep cleanings with detergents, preserving the shell, padding, and lining over time.
For users who are prone to skin problems such as dermatitis or acne, especially in sensitive areas around the head and face, maintaining a clean helmet is critical. A helmet cleaner machine minimizes the risk factors associated with microbial buildup, promoting skin health and providing peace of mind that your helmet environment is safe and sanitized.
Prolonging Helmet Lifespan and Maintaining Structural Integrity
Helmets are significant investments, designed to protect heads from high-impact collisions, and they must maintain their structural integrity to be effective. Dirt, sweat, and residues found inside helmets can degrade foam padding and liner materials, which are essential for shock absorption. Using a helmet cleaner machine can help extend the lifespan of your helmet by preserving the internal components more effectively than manual cleaning.
Traditional cleaning methods often involve water, soap, or disinfectants, which if not properly managed, may negatively affect the helmet’s lining and padding – sometimes causing them to break down prematurely. The advantage of helmet cleaner machines lies in their ability to clean without soaking or saturating these materials, relying instead on specialized steam, ozone, or gentle vapor to reach and clean difficult areas without causing moisture damage.
Furthermore, prolonged exposure to sweat and grime can degrade helmet straps and buckles, leading to potential safety hazards. Helmet cleaner machines often come with customized cleaning cycles designed to address these components gently but thoroughly. By ensuring these parts are well maintained and free from corrosive elements like salt from sweat, the overall mechanism that secures the helmet remains robust.
Extending the operational lifespan of a helmet isn’t just about saving money; it is a critical safety issue. Helmets that begin to show wear and tear in their internal protective layers move towards diminished protective capabilities. Regular use of a helmet cleaner machine ensures that your helmet remains both hygienic and structurally sound for as long as possible, maintaining the highest level of protection every time you wear it.

Protecting Helmet Materials with Gentle and Specialized Cleaning Methods
Helmet materials are often delicate and engineered for safety rather than ease of cleaning. The outer shell’s paintwork, the visor, foam padding, and fabrics used in the lining each require special attention when cleaned to avoid damage or deterioration. Traditional cleaning agents or improper scrubbing techniques can cause discoloration, warping, or weakening of these materials.
Helmet cleaner machines are specifically designed to handle these challenges by utilizing cleaning methods that are non-abrasive and precise. For example, ozone cleaning and steam cleaning use the power of oxidizing agents or moisture vapor at controlled temperatures to break down dirt while preserving materials. Unlike harsh chemical detergents, these techniques leave no residue or harsh chemicals that could affect paint or components.
Moreover, certain helmet cleaner machines incorporate soft bristle brushes or specially engineered cleaning chambers that support the helmet without causing pressure points, scratches, or deformation. This is especially important for helmets with intricate shapes or visors that require careful handling.
Regular use of inappropriate cleaning approaches, such as immersing helmets in water or rubbing with abrasive materials, can void helmet warranties or reduce their safety certifications. In contrast, helmet cleaner machines abide by manufacturers’ recommendations and integrate cleaning modes that maintain the helmet’s aesthetic qualities and functional specifications.
The protective layers in helmets contribute to visibility, safety, and comfort; hence their upkeep is essential. Helmet cleaner machines ensure each part of the helmet receives the right level of care, limiting wear and maintaining the helmet’s appearance and performance over time.
